James "Jim" W. Warner, of Felton, entered into God's care, after a brief illness, on Sunday, April 28, 2019 at 8:55 am at Wellspan York Hospital at the age of 92. He was the husband of Madaline G. (Gladfelter) Warner to whom he married on Oct. 10, 1953 with whom he celebrated 65 years of marriage. Jim was born in York, on August 12, 1926, and was the son of the late, James S. and Mammie (Ness) Warner. He worked at the Red Lion Cabinet Co., and then at Automotive Service in York, retiring in 1994, after 41 years of service. He was a member of the Bethany United Methodist Church in Felton and a United States Navy Veteran. Jim enjoyed eating hard shell crabs, hunting, fishing with his son, family and friends, he loved spending time working on puzzles. Jim graduated from Red Lion High School, Class of 1945.
